21xrx.com
2024-09-19 09:34:24 Thursday
登录
文章检索 我的文章 写文章
C++语言中,整数常量有四种。
2023-07-04 17:42:13 深夜i     --     --
C++ 整数常量 四种

在C++语言中,整数常量是常见的变量类型之一。整数常量的类型可以分为四类,分别为十进制、八进制、十六进制和二进制。

首先是十进制常量。这是最常用的整数常量类型,它包含数字0-9。十进制常量可以以任意的数字序列开始,例如12、345、6789等。此外,还可以添加符号来表示正或负数。例如,-123表示负数,+456代表正数。

其次是八进制常量。八进制常量以数字0开头,后跟2-7的数字序列。例如,八进制数047表示十进制数39。八进制常量在现代编程中用得并不普遍,但在一些早期的编程语言中很常见。

第三种整数常量类型是十六进制常量。十六进制常量以前缀“0x”或“0X”开始,其后可以包含数字0-9和字母A-F(大小写不敏感)。例如,0x3F代表十进制数63。十六进制常量在编写某些程序时很有用,例如编写底层程序时。

最后是二进制常量。二进制常量以前缀“0b”或“0B”开始,其后可以包含数字0或1。例如,0b101代表十进制数5。二进制常量通常用于位运算或处理二进制数据。

在编写C++程序时,理解整数常量的不同类型对于正确使用它们非常重要。根据实际需求,选择正确的整数常量类型能够使程序变得更有效率和可读性更高。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复